Mastering the NBME 19 Difficulty: A Strategic Guide to Success

Many test takers refer to NBME 19 as a challenging assessment that mirrors the complexity of USMLE Step 1. This article breaks down what drives that perception and how examinees can approach each phase of the exam.

Understanding the specific elements that contribute to NBME 19 difficulty helps you set realistic expectations and allocate study time efficiently.

NBME 19 difficulty often stems from how questions embed basic science principles inside detailed clinical scenarios. You must recognize the core pathophysiology before selecting the most appropriate next step.

Many items require simultaneous consideration of病史, physical findings, and diagnostic data. Strong memorization alone is usually insufficient for optimal performance.

Managing Time Pressure and Pacing Strategies

The exam’s pacing demands can amplify NBME 19 difficulty, especially when lengthy stems hide the key point until the final sentences. Practicing efficient review of only relevant details is essential.

Develop a consistent strategy for reading, highlighting critical findings, and deciding when to move on. Frequent full-length timed practices help calibrate your internal clock.

Leveraging Content Breadth and Subject Prioritization

Because NBME 19 covers a broad spectrum of topics, test takers often encounter material outside their strongest areas. Focused review using an error log allows you to prioritize high-yield weak zones.

Targeting frequently tested disciplines while maintaining a lightweight review of lower-yield topics can reduce perceived NBME 19 difficulty.

Adapting to Variable Test Item Styles and Formats

NBME 19 difficulty is also influenced by shifts in item style, including standalone questions and sequential items that depend on previous answers. Familiarity with both formats reduces surprises on test day.

Exposure to diverse question types across multiple practice exams builds flexibility in interpretation and response selection.

Key Takeaways and Actionable Recommendations

  • Use an error log to identify patterns in missed questions and focus review.
  • Practice full-length, timed exams to improve pacing and reduce anxiety.
  • Integrate basic science pathophysiology with clinical decision-making drills.
  • Simulate test conditions with varying question styles to build flexibility.
  • Prioritize high-yield disciplines while maintaining a balanced review schedule.

How does NBME 19 difficulty compare to earlier NBME exams I have taken?

Many find NBME 19 slightly more complex due to longer stems and tighter integration of clinical details, but the fundamental scoring and subject coverage remain consistent with earlier versions.

Do the new question formats in NBME 19 make the test harder to finish on time?

Sequential and multi-step items can feel time-consuming, so practicing rapid discrimination of key facts and disciplined pacing is crucial to managing the overall clock.

How heavily does NBME 19 difficulty weight basic science knowledge versus clinical judgment?

Clinical judgment is emphasized more than in some prior exams, yet a solid foundation in pathophysiology and mechanism remains necessary to decode the scenarios correctly.

Can targeted review really reduce NBME 19 difficulty for someone who is already well-prepared?

Yes, refining weak subtopics, sharpening test-taking patterns, and building endurance through timed practice can meaningfully lower perceived difficulty even for strong students.
